The Value of a Physical Message

A handwritten letter is not just text – it is a piece of your soul, proof that you gave time and attention. In the digital age, an envelope opened with emotion can bring deeper joy than any notification.

Classic Accessories for an Elegant Ritual

Choose a fine-nib fountain pen and a dark blue or sepia ink. Textured paper, a wax seal, and a few pressed flowers turn a simple postcard into a personal work of art, worthy of a collection.

How to Make Each Sending Unique

Add a small drawing, a phrase from a beloved book, or a shared memory. A pinch of dried lavender or a quote written by your own hand transforms the gesture into a lasting memory, to be cherished.
